Sunday 6th March, 2016. Cruising the Atlantic Ocean



We woke up this morning to find a soggy invitation under our door. The invitation was to a Columbus Club cocktail party. The reason it was soggy is that our cabin (and a good few others) had been flooded during the night when they emptied the swimming pool. The pool is on deck 8 but there was a leak in the pipes on our level - deck 4. The water had luckily not entered our wardrobe but had crept about half way down the cabin and the carpet was soaked. The housekeeping staff were frantically using sucking machines to suck up as much water as possible. We had got off lightly - the whole ceiling of the inside cabin opposite us had come down (luckily it was not occupied). A few of the guest lecturers on the port side had to be moved as everything was wet (including their equipment). Once they had finished sucking they brought in a very loud dehumidifier. M has developed a really bad cold and cough. After lunch she was feeling so poorly that she needed to rest but the racket in the cabin was awful. The lovely Olga called to ask if we were OK after the inundation and M explained the problem. M was promptly given an inside cabin on deck 7 so she could have a rest. After dinner we went back to the cabin as M was feeling too ill to go to any of the entertainment.
